Understanding Code Reviews

Definition and Purpose of Code Reviews

Code reviews are a critical part of the software development process. They involve a careful examination of code to identify errors, security vulnerabilities, and areas for improvement. The purpose of code reviews is to enhance code quality, maintainability, and reliability. By having multiple sets of eyes review the code, developers can identify and fix issues before they become major problems.

Different Types of Code Reviews

There are several types of code reviews, including:

  1. Formal Inspections: Formal inspections involve a structured and rigorous review process, often led by a moderator. This type of code review is time-consuming but highly effective in identifying defects.
  2. Pair Programming: Pair programming involves two developers working together on the same code simultaneously. This approach allows for immediate feedback and collaboration.
  3. Tool-Assisted Reviews: Tool-assisted reviews use specialized software tools to automate and streamline the code review process. These tools can analyze code for defects, compliance with coding standards, and performance issues.
  4. Over-the-Shoulder Reviews: Over-the-shoulder reviews are informal and involve one developer reviewing the code of another developer in real-time. This approach is useful for quick feedback and knowledge sharing.
  5. Email-based Reviews: Email-based reviews involve developers sending code snippets or files via email for review. This approach allows for asynchronous review but may lack the collaborative aspect of other methods.

CFDs and Real Cryptos

Explanation of CFDs and Their Use in Trading

CFDs, or Contracts for Difference, are financial derivatives that allow traders to speculate on the price movements of various underlying assets, such as stocks, commodities, currencies, and cryptocurrencies, without owning the assets themselves. With CFDs, traders can profit from both rising and falling markets by taking long or short positions.

Key Differences Between CFDs and Real Cryptos

While both CFDs and real cryptos are related to trading in the cryptocurrency market, there are significant differences between the two:

  1. Ownership: With real cryptos, traders actually own the underlying cryptocurrency, while CFDs are purely speculative instruments without ownership of the asset.
  2. Regulation: Real cryptos are subject to regulatory frameworks specific to each jurisdiction, while CFDs may be subject to different regulations governing derivatives trading.
  3. Market Access: Real cryptos can be bought and sold on cryptocurrency exchanges, while CFDs are typically traded through regulated brokers offering CFD trading services.
